Audience Editor, Special Projects
USA TODAY Co., Inc. is a diversified media company dedicated to empowering and enriching communities. The Audience Editor, Special Projects is responsible for ensuring high standards of digital content across emerging verticals, supervising a team of Digital Content Producers, and executing the content strategy.

Responsibilities
Supervise and mentor Digital Content Producers, providing feedback and ensuring quality, accuracy, and consistency across all content formats
Lead copy/script editing for videos, stories, social posts, and multimedia content, upholding rigorous journalistic, ethical, and legal standards
Review and approve content to ensure alignment with brand voice and audience engagement goals
Ensure the content is inclusive and reflects the communities we serve
Collaborate with the Senior Manager to implement content strategies that drive audience growth and engagement
Contribute to the development and execution of editorial plans for new and existing products
Use audience data and analytics to inform content decisions and optimize performance
Evaluate, pilot, and scale new tools or workflows—including the use Automation and AI—to expand content offerings and handle routine tasks
Collaborate with the Platform Editor to ensure producers are contributing timely and relevant content for topical newsletters and social media platforms
Maintain and update the editorial calendar, coordinating assignments and deadlines for staff and freelancers
Ensure efficient workflow and timely publication of all content
Adapt quickly to shifting priorities and support the team through industry changes
Assign, brief, and manage freelance contributors, ensuring timely delivery and adherence to editorial guidelines
Serve as the primary point of contact for freelancers, facilitating communication and resolving issues as needed
Qualification
Required
Bachelor's degree in journalism, communications, or a related field, or equivalent work
3+ years of experience in text, video and social content creation, editing, or journalism, with at least 1 year in a supervisory or lead role
Exceptional copy editing and writing skills, with a strong command of AP style and digital best practices
Experience managing or coordinating freelance/contract contributors
Proficiency with content management systems, editorial calendars, and analytics tools (e.g., Google Analytics, Parse.ly)
Strong organizational, multitasking, and communication skills
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ced, deadline-driven environment
Commitment to fostering an inclusive and supportive team culture
Candidates should have facility with AI and automation and experience in using it to enhance their journalism
Experience with short-form video editing and multimedia content
Familiarity with workflow automation, AI tools, or emerging digital platforms
